
A podcast where a group of friends talk about all things geek. We may be married, single, businessmen, educators, artists, lovers, fighters you name it, but we all have a bit of geek in us. Each episode we leave our fate in the roll of a die as it determines what subject we talk about. There's lots of laughter, plenty of us making fun of each other and moments of seriousness.
